: : The material is extremely light-weight, even lighter than the Willis & Geiger shirt, but it is still very durable in terms of strength and stitching. The colour depends on the light you're in, sometimes it looks almost tan, but in other light you clearly see the stone shades, and in bright light it's similar to the colour in the streets of Cairo.
: : What I'm sure will provoke the biggest debate is the colour of the buttons, they are the colour seen in `Temple of Doom,' and `Last Crusade,' and in certain scenes in `Raiders.' I wish I could scan photos, because in certain stills from `Raiders' you can see that Indy's shirt buttons are dark, and at other times they are a white-ish colour. Clearly there are two different button colours in `Raiders.'
: : This is pretty nit-picky and I usually don't pour over such details, but I'm sure lots of people are concerned with this.
: : finally, the shirt is cosmetically identical to Indy's shirt, just like everyone says. THE BEST part though is that, to quote my significant other, "It's really slimming."
